Risks: Project Risks.

· Security- since our information can be stolen by co-workers and use for their benefits.

· Schedule- if a schedule can fluctuate it can cause latency in the entire project

· Team Members- some member may fail to corporate and fail to be open-minded

· Cost Estimates and budgeting – we may low the estimates which will affect of project negatively.

· Performance- low quality and security risks may be due to low performance.
